Our fully-furnished & equipped STUDIO is located in the heart of Summertown - a stone’s throw from shops, restaurants and bus routes to the City Centre. It is situated on the lower ground floor, has its own entrance and guests also have access to the garden at the front of the house.
It’s the perfect location for those visiting, working or studying in Oxford. Ideal for NHS staff, medical researchers or graduate students with direct bus routes to the hospitals & the University in central Oxford.
The STUDIO is located on the lower ground floor of a charming Victorian house in the heart of Summertown in North Oxford - only moments away from the thriving restaurants, shops and bars. The studio contains a fully-equipped, integrated kitchenette, bathroom with shower and toilet, Wi-fi internet and Smart TV. Accessed via its own private entrance, it’s perfect for couples and single guests visiting Oxford who wish to stay in this exclusive and fashionable area of Oxford.
There are excellent transport links in Summertown - it’s a 9 minute bus ride or 30 minute walk to the city centre.
The studio itself has a very comfortable double bed and a small dining table to enjoy meals. The kitchenette contains all necessary cooking equipment, a fridge/freezer, microwave and a cooking plate. There is a toaster & kettle, cutlery, and wine glasses etc. There is no washing machine or dryer and we therefore recommend guests can use the OXWASH service or the local laudrette.
Kitchen basics (tea/coffee/salt & pepper/oil etc) are supplied.

About the area
Oxfordshire, nestled in the heart of England, is a quintessential British destination that offers a rich tapestry of history, academia, and bucolic landscapes. It is most famously known for the city of Oxford, home to the prestigious University of Oxford, the oldest university in the English-speaking world. The university's historic colleges, such as Christ Church and Magdalen, boast stunning architecture and are open to visitors who wish to walk in the footsteps of scholars and statesmen.
The county's appeal extends beyond its academic prestige. Oxfordshire is dotted with picturesque villages and market towns like Woodstock, home to the magnificent Blenheim Palace, a UNESCO World Heritage Site and the birthplace of Sir Winston Churchill. The palace's baroque architecture, opulent state rooms, and sprawling parklands are a testament to England's grandeur and are a must-visit for history enthusiasts.
For those seeking a tranquil escape, the rolling hills of the Cotswolds offer a serene backdrop for walking, cycling, and horseback riding. This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ty is characterized by its charming stone cottages, gentle streams, and vibrant wildflowers. The Cotswolds also provide a canvas for outdoor activities such as hot air ballooning, offering panoramic views of the countryside.
Oxfordshire's culinary scene is a delight, with traditional pubs serving hearty British fare, farmers' markets offering local produce, and fine dining establishments that showcase the best of British gastronomy. The county's rich agricultural heritage is celebrated in its food festivals and ale trails, inviting visitors to savor the flavors of the region.
The River Thames meanders through Oxfordshire, providing opportunities for boating, kayaking, and riverside picnics. The Thames Path National Trail is perfect for those who enjoy leisurely walks along the water's edge, with plenty of wildlife and historical sites to discover along the way.
For culture vultures, Oxfordshire's theaters, galleries, and museums offer a diverse array of artistic and intellectual pursuits. The Ashmolean Museum, the oldest public museum in the UK, houses an extensive collection of art and archaeology, while modern art aficionados can explore the cutting-edge exhibitions at Modern Art Oxford.
In essence, Oxfordshire is a destination that offers a harmonious blend of intellectual stimulation, historical exploration, and natural beauty. It caters to a wide range of interests, from the scholarly to the pastoral, making it an enriching and delightful place to visit for travelers of all inclinations.
